Large Beam Collimators for MM Fibers SMA
By using an air gap bonded lens, this collimator can provide better beam quality than aspherical lenses and achromatic lenses in terms of collimation performance. The design of a low aberration lens group can achieve a beam closer to a Gaussian beam, with smaller divergence angles and smaller wavefront errors.

Large Beam Collimators for MM Fibers Broadband SMA
Specifications
Wavelength: | 450 - 1550 nm |
---|---|
Bandwidth: | ±30 nm |
Beam Waist Diameter: | 14.6 - 19.4 mm |
Divergence Angle: | 2.3 - 12.5 mrad |
EFL: | 33.5 - 37.1 mm |
NA (Lens): | 0.25, 0.26, 0.27 |
Fiber Type:: | 62.5/125; 200/220; 400/440; 105/125; 200/220; 400/440 |
Connectors:: | FC/PC SMA 905 |
Transmittance: | >92% |

Frequently Asked Questions
What wavelengths are available for the YSD series products?
The YSD series products are available in the following wavelengths: 450nm, 488nm, 520nm, 633nm, 780nm, 850nm, and 1064nm.
What is the transmittance of the YSD series products?
The transmittance of the YSD series products is ≥92% for certain models, ensuring high efficiency in light transmission.
What are the divergence angles of the YSD series?
The divergence angles of the YSD series range from 2.2mrad to 12.8mrad, depending on the specific model.
What is the input fiber type for YSD series products?
The input fiber types vary among models, including 62.5/125, 105/125, 200/220, and 400/440.
What is the beam size range for the YSD series?
The beam size for the YSD series ranges from approximately 14.6mm to 19.4mm, with a tolerance of ±10%.
What lens numerical aperture (NA) values are available in the YSD series?
The lens numerical aperture (NA) values for the YSD series are either 0.27 or 0.22, depending on the model.
What is the typical package size for the YSD series products?
The typical package size for YSD series products is around Φ24*L39mm to Φ24*L42mm, depending on the model.
